Advertisement
Tyrus is on tour now! ***ONSALE***
https://tinyurl.com/tyrustickets
#onsale #now
Event Venue & Nearby Stays
Walhalla Performing Arts Center, 101 E North Broad St,Walhalla, South Carolina, United States
Tickets